Mozilla/5.0 (Linux; Android 12; 2201117TY)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/106.0.0.0 Mobile Safari/537.36
Данный User-Agent представляет собой строку, которую отправляет браузер Google Chrome версии 106, работающий на операционной системе Android 12. Браузер разработан компанией Google на базе движка Blink. Этот User-Agent используется для идентификации устройства и браузера при обращении к веб-серверам. Строка содержит информацию о модели устройства (2201117TY), версии Android, движке рендеринга WebKit и самом браузере Chrome. Chrome является самым популярным браузером в мире с долей рынка более 65% (по данным StatCounter на июль 2024).
Данный User-Agent считается безопасным и характерен для легитимного мобильного браузера. Однако, его можно подделать. Основные риски: подмена User-Agent злоумышленниками для обхода ограничений или имитации мобильного трафика. Рекомендуется дополнительно проверять другие заголовки (Accept, Accept-Language, Sec-CH-UA) и поведение клиента. Доверять такому User-Agent стоит только в сочетании с другими сигналами безопасности (например, наличие корректных заголовков Client Hints).
Для идентификации User-Agent на сервере можно использовать регулярное выражение. Пример на PHP: preg_match('/Chrome\/106\.0\.0\.0/i', $userAgent). На JavaScript: navigator.userAgent.includes('Chrome/106.0.0.0'). В .htaccess для блокировки: RewriteCond %{HTTP_USER_AGENT} Chrome/106.0.0.0 [NC]. Для анализа используйте библиотеки типа ua-parser. Учитывайте, что версия может незначительно отличаться (106.0.0.0 - общая маска).